WebJul 31, 2014 · When using pytest fixture with mock.patch, test parameter order is crucial. If you place a fixture parameter before a mocked one: from unittest import mock @mock.patch('my.module.my.class') def test_my_code(my_fixture, mocked_class): then the mock object will be in my_fixture and mocked_class will be search as a fixture: WebFeb 19, 2024 · While pytest supports receiving fixtures via test function arguments for non-unittest test methods, unittest.TestCase methods cannot directly receive fixture function arguments as implementing that is likely to inflict on the ability to run general unittest.TestCase test suites. ... In this example I do mock the pd.read_csv method with …
fixture-monkey-engine Fixture Monkey
WebCeiling Lighting Monkey Pendant Light, Vintage Resin Hemp Rope Monkey Hanging Lighting Fixture Industrial Retro Ceiling Pendant Lamp Chandelier for Living Room Bedroom Bar Cafe (Pendant Ligh. No reviews. £28799. Get it Thursday, 23 Mar - Wednesday, 29 Mar. FREE Delivery. WebDec 28, 2024 · @pytest.fixture (scope='module') def monkeymodule (): with pytest.MonkeyPatch.context () as mp: yield mp @pytest.fixture (scope='function') def external_access (monkeymodule): external_access = mock.MagicMock () external_access.get_something = mock.MagicMock ( return_value='Mock was used.') … shangrila shaw edsa restaurants
Monkeypatching/mocking modules and environments - pytest
WebHEDMAI Monkey Lamp Pendant Light Lamp Shade Cable Resin Pendant Lamp Nordic Creative Ceiling Lamp, E27 Acrylic Lampshade Monkey Hanging Lamp LED Chandelier Restaurant Bedroom,White,Hanging. No reviews. £14999. Get it Monday, 20 Mar - Saturday, 25 Mar. £6.00 delivery. Options: WebMonkeypatching/mocking modules and environments¶. Sometimes tests need to invoke functionality which dependson global settings or which invokes code which cannot be … WebMar 6, 2024 · Hello, Fixture Monkey. Fixture Monkey would help you make countless complicate test objects. Fixture Monkey has two goals to achieve. Fixture Monkey has two different generating object structures since 0.4. 0.3 would be deprecated since 1.0, Fixture Monkey instance supports 0.4 then. shangri la shophouse